Output 66864fc5fb573b5e3f30b36ace08628c4f1232dcec42e085fd4fbd54694d298c:1

value
58647644
script pubkey
OP_0 OP_PUSHBYTES_20 4bd89af899519ec4bf7ddd8002450ccc38672522
address
bc1qf0vf47ye2x0vf0mamkqqy3gvesuxwffzn4jfhn
transaction
66864fc5fb573b5e3f30b36ace08628c4f1232dcec42e085fd4fbd54694d298c
confirmations
50101
spent
true